Introduction to Vulnerability Assessments
Definition and Importance
Vulnerability assessments are systematic evaluations of software systems aimed at identifying security weaknesses. They play a crucial role in safeguarding sensitive data and maintaining operational integrity. By proactively addressing vulnerabilities, organizations can mitigate potential financial losses and reputational damage. This approach is essential in today’s digital landscape. Security is paramount. Regular assessments ensure compliance with industry standards. He must prioritize these evaluations for effective risk management. After all, prevention is better than cure.
Overview of Software Vulnerabilities
Software vulnerabilities are flaws that can be exploited, leading to unauthorized access or data breaches. These weaknesses can arise from coding errors, misconfigurations, or outdated software. Identifying these vulnerabilities is essential for protecting sensitive information. Security is a top priority. Organizations must regularly assess their systems to mitigate risks. He should not underestimate the impact of these vulnerabilities. Awareness is key in today’s digital environment.
The Vulnerability Assessment Process
Planning and Preparation
Effective planning and preparation are crucial for a successful vulnerability assessment. He should begin by defining the scope and objectives clearly. This includes identifying critical assets and potential threats. A well-structured plan enhances efficiency. Key steps include assembling a skilled team, selecting appropriate tools, and establishing a timeline. Organization is essential. He must ensure all stakeholders are informed. Communication fosters collaboration.
Execution and Analysis
During execution, he must conduct thorough scans and assessments of the software systems. This involves using specialized tools to identify vulnerabilities. Accurate data collection is vital. He should analyze the results to determine the severity of each vulnerability. Priorirization is essential for effective remediation. He must focus on high-risk issues first. Timely action is crucial. Each finding should be documented for future reference.
Types of Vulnerability Assessments
Network Vulnerability Assessments
Network vulnerability assessments focus on identifying weaknesses within an organization’s network infrastructure. This process includes scanning for open ports, misconfigurations, and outdated software. He must evaluate potential entry points for attackers. Understanding these vulnerabilities is critical. Each identified risk should be assessed for its potential impact. Prioritizing risks helps allocate resources effectively. Security is non-negotiable in today’s environment.
Application Vulnerability Assessments
Application vulnerability assessments target weaknesses in software applications. This includes analyzing code for security flaws and testing for input validation issues. He must ensure that sensitive data is protected. Identifying these vulnerabilities is essential for maintaining user trust. Each flaw can lead to significant financial repercussions. He should prioritize fixing high-risk vulnerabilities first. Security is paramount in application development.
Tools and Techniques for Vulnerability Assessment
Automated Scanning Tools
Automated scanning tools streamline the vulnerability assessment process by quickly identifying potential security issues. These tools can analyze large volumes of data efficiently. He must select tools that align with specific needs. Accurate results are crucial for effective remediation. Each tool offers unique features and capabilities. He should evaluate them carefully. Automation saves time and resources. Security is a continuous effort.
Manual Testing Techniques
Manual testing techniques involve a hands-on approach to identify vulnerabilities that automated tools may overlook. This method requires skilled professionals to analyze applications and networks critically. He must focus on areas like user input and authentication processes. Thorough examination is essential for uncovering hidden risks. Each finding should be documented meticulously. Attention to detail is vital. He should combine manual testing with automated tools. Security is a shared responsibility.
Interpreting Vulnerability Assessment Results
Understanding Risk Levels
Understanding risk levels is crucial for effective vulnerability management. He must categorize vulnerabilities based on their potential impact and exploitability. This classification helps prioritize remediation efforts. High-risk vulnerabilities require immediate attention. He should assess the likelihood of exploitation carefully. Each risk level informs resourcefulness allocation decisions. Timely action can prevent significant financial losses. Awareness is essential for informed decision-making .
Prioritizing Vulnerabilities for Remediation
Prioritizing vulnerabilities for remediation is essential for effective risk management. He must evaluate each vulnerability’s potential impact on the organization. This assessment helps determine which issues to address first. High-priority vulnerabilities pose significant risks. He should allocate resources accordingly. Timely remediation can prevent costly breaches. Each decision should be data-driven. Security is a continuous process.
Best Practices for Conducting Vulnerability Assessments
Regular Assessment Schedules
Establishing regular assessment schedules is vital for maintaining security. He should conduct assessments at least quarterly. This frequency helps identify new vulnerabilities promptly. Additionally, he must consider assessments after significant changes. Each assessment should follow a structured approach. Consistency is key for effective monitoring. He should document findings meticulously. Security is an ongoing commitment.
Incorporating Findings into Development Cycles
Incorporating findings into development cycles enhances
The Future of Vulnerability Assessments
Emerging Trends in Cybersecurity
Emerging trends in cybersecurity are shaping the future of vulnerability assessments. He must focus on integrating artificial intelligence to enhance detection capabilities. This technology can analyze vast data sets quickly. Additionally, he should consider the rise of automated threat intelligence. Real-time insights are crucial for proactive measures. Each trend emphasizes the need for adaptability. Security is an evolving challenge.
Impact of AI and Machine Learning
The impact of AI and machine learning on vulnerability assessments is profound. These technologies enable predictive analytics to identify potential threats. He must leverage algorithms to enhance detection accuracy. Additionally, machine learning can adapt to evolving attack patterns. This adaptability improves response times significantly. Each advancement reduces the risk of breaches. Security is becoming increasingly data-driven.